Coventry Bees have agreed terms with Danish rider Hans Andersen over a proposed transfer to Brandon. Bees hope to have the World Cup winner signed in time to take on what would be his former club Peterborough Panthers on 7 August. At present Andersen is serving a 14-day Elite League ban which should expire on Monday, 4 August. "I'm looking forward to getting back on the bike and riding for Coventry," the Dane told BBC Coventry & Warwickshire. The Elite League ban was imposed after Andersen refused to ride for Peterborough because of unpaid wages. Andersen will join Bees' other recent signing, the young Czech rider Filip Sitera.
